The Associated Press announced its All-SEC teams Wednesday, and Oklahoma wide receiver Isaiah Sategna III, kicker Tate Sandell and punter Grayson Miller were named to the All-SEC First Team in a vote by media members who cover the conference on a regular basis. Three more Sooners – defensive linemen Gracen Halton and R Mason Thomas and linebacker Owen Heinecke – were named to the All-SEC Second Team.
Oklahoma senior defensive lineman R Mason Thomas, redshirt junior kicker Tate Sandell and redshirt junior punter Grayson Miller were named to the All-SEC First Team, and seven more Sooners earned a total of eight second- and third-team honors, the conference office announced Tuesday. Selections were made by the league’s head coaches, who were not permitted to vote for their own players.
OKLAHOMA CITY (AP) — Shai Gilgeous-Alexander scored 28 points, and the Oklahoma City Thunder matched the best 25game start to an NBA season by dominating the Phoenix Suns 138-89 in an NBA Cup quarterfinal on Wednesday.
ORLANDO, Fla. (AP) — Closer Edwin Díaz has agreed to a $69 million, threeyear contract with the World Series champion Los Angeles Dodgers, a person familiar with the negotiations told The Associated Press.
